2. Mukti

Based in Australia, Mukti is a smart choice if you're looking for cruelty-free skincare. Mukti works to create organic and natural products that are safe and non-irritating.

They have products that are all made in Australia. Additionally, they allow customers to visit them and see how their products are made.

9. Alba Botanica

Owned by Hain Celestial Group, Inc, Alba Botanica is a beautiful option to purchase any cruelty-free beauty product. The brand focuses on ecology, thanks to which all its products are recyclable and do not contain artificial dyes.

They focus on using plant-based solutions, so you can rest assured that your products will never be made at the expense of any creature.
